Ada E. Yonath was born on 22.06.1939 in Israel.

Her family moved to Tel Aviv and she was accepted in Tichon Hadash high school. She has returned to graduating in Jerusalem and there she finished her education in 1964 with a master's degree in biochemistry.

Ada E. Yonath has been first scientist in the world who observed the structure of big ribosome subsystem. Then

Venkatraman Ramakrishnan and Thomas A. Steitz begun to study protein biosynthesis with her. In 2009 they won a Nobel Prize for their work.

In 2000 the first European Crystallography Prize In 2002 the Israel Prize for chemistry In 2006 the Wolf Prize in Chemistry for ingenious structural discoveries of the ribosomal machinery of peptidebond formation and the light-driven primary processes in photosynthesis In 2008, she became the first Israeli woman to win the L`Oreal UNESCO Award for Women in Science for her vital work identifying how bacteria become resistant to antibiotics

In 2009, the Nobel Prize in Chemistry (with Venkatraman Ramakrishnan and Thomas A. Steitz ). She has been the first Israeli woman to be awarded a Nobel Prize.
